Unhappy R.I.P. Steve Irwin

CROCODILE HUNTER DEAD

Australian naturalist STEVE IRWIN has died after being stung in the chest by a stingray while diving on the Great Barrier Reef early today (Sept 4/2006). The charismatic star, dubbed the Crocodile Hunter after his hit TV show, was diving off Australia's northeast coast filming an underwater documentary. Local diving operator STEVE EDMONDSON, whose Poseidon boats were out on the Great Barrier Reef when the accident occurred, confirms, "Steve was hit by a stingray in the chest. "He probably died from a cardiac arrest from the injury." Although paramedics rushed the 44-year-old to hospital by helicopter, he was dead before they arrived, police said. The daredevil star garnered a cult following for his TV antics, which included wrestling snakes and crocodiles. He also played himself in 2002 movie THE CROCODILE HUNTER: COLLISION COURSE and made a cameo appearance alongside EDDIE MURPHY in the 2001 movie DR DOLITTLE 2. Irwin is survived by wife TERRI and their two children, BINDI SUE and BOB CLARENCE.
